Assume cursor is positioned right before aaa in the following example. Then cursor is moved down one line. So we see that the text from aaa to eee is selected (including):
Example:
Some text aaa more text
eee
But macro "Transpose Cursor and Anchor Positions" fails. The reason is that the macro wants to move the cursor to the right in the second line. But the line is not long enough.
